birth & death dates per PA Death Certificate # 19581; cause of death hypertrophic biliary cirrhosis; buried 7 Feb 1933
*******************************************************************
The News-Sun (Newport, PA), 9 Feb 1933 (Thu), page 5
Mrs. Annie Burd Arter, wife of the late Patrick Henry Arter of Duncannon died Saturday at the home of her daughter, Mrs. R. H. Shover at Perdix. She was 65 years old. The deceased was a daughter of Anninas and Sara (Long) Burd, was born at Donnally Mills.
She is survived by her daughter, Ruth, Mrs. Shover, one grandson and two brothers, S. W. Burd, of Newport and Prof. W. H. Burd of Altoona. Funeral services were held at the Shover home Tuesday at 10.30 o'clock with the Rev. Charles R. Beittel, pastor of the Otterbein United Brethren church of Harrisburg officiating. Burial was in the Newport Cemetery. Pallbearers were Earl Bushey, Alfred Ensminger, C. P. Wagner, C. R. Morgan, Bernard and Raymond Benfer.
